4444 W. 147th St. | Midlothian, Illinois, 60445-2644 Moran Family of Brands got its start in 1958 as Dennis Moran, the original owner of the company, began a career in the automotive aftermarket industry.
Over the years Mr. Morans entrepreneurial spirit was evident as he built the original business around automotive resale & wholesale and eventually saw the need for automotive and transmission parts and repair services. In 1990, Mr. Moran and his youngest daughter Barb founded Moran Industries and expanded the business model to include franchised repair facilities with the acquisition of Mr. Transmission.
Through hard work, commitment to customers and development of innovative products and services, Dennis and Barb built the business into one of the leading transmission, auto repair and accessory franchises in the country. Barb has led the company through a changing industry and has served as the President and CEO since 1999.
